Burris out of 2010 run; Senate race wide open

Roland Burris may have relieved Illinois Democrats of their biggest political headache and reduced Republican chances of capturing a valuable Senate seat next year by announcing Friday he won’t run for a full term. Still, his withdrawal sets the stage for a major clash of political forces in 2010.

Democrats no longer have to worry about a messy primary battle focused on Burris accepting his seat from former Gov. Rod Blagojevich, now removed from office and facing multiple corruption charges. And Republicans won’t have a chance to run against the tainted appointee.

Even so, Republicans who run are sure to campaign against the scandals surrounding Blagojevich in this Democrat-controlled state.
